NetBSD-Bugs arch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

kern/59497: Panic in ucompoll



>Number:         59497
>Category:       kern
>Synopsis:       Panic in ucompoll
>Confidential:   no
>Severity:       serious
>Priority:       medium
>Responsible:    kern-bug-people
>State:          open
>Class:          sw-bug
>Submitter-Id:   net
>Arrival-Date:   Tue Jul 01 09:20:00 +0000 2025
>Originator:     Paul Ripke
>Release:        NetBSD 10.1_STABLE
>Organization:
Paul Ripke
"Great minds discuss ideas, average minds discuss events, small minds
 discuss people."
-- Disputed: Often attributed to Eleanor Roosevelt. 1948.
>Environment:
System: NetBSD slave 10.1_STABLE NetBSD 10.1_STABLE (SLAVE) #17: Fri Apr 18 13:51:35 AEST 2025 stix@slave:/home/netbsd/netbsd-10/obj.amd64/home/netbsd/netbsd-10/src/sys/arch/amd64/compile/SLAVE amd64
Architecture: x86_64
Machine: amd64
>Description:
Crash appears due to intermittent disconnect/reconnect of a uplcom device while open.

Device is:
addr 54: full speed, power 100 mA, config 1, USB-Serial Controller D(0x2303), Prolific Technology Inc.(0x067b), rev 4.00(0x0400)

uplcom0 at uhub9 port 1
uplcom0: Prolific Technology Inc. (0x067b) USB-Serial Controller D (0x2303), rev 1.10/4.00, addr 5
ucom0 at uplcom0

Periodically:
Jun 28 14:27:01 slave /netbsd: [ 2332157.9354694] ucom2: detached
Jun 28 14:27:01 slave /netbsd: [ 2332157.9354694] uplcom1: detached
Jun 28 14:27:01 slave /netbsd: [ 2332157.9354694] uplcom1: at uhub1 port 8 (addr 52) disconnected
Jun 28 14:27:10 slave /netbsd: [ 2332166.7886134] uplcom1 at uhub1 port 8
Jun 28 14:27:10 slave /netbsd: [ 2332166.7886134] uplcom1: Prolific Technology Inc. (0x067b) USB-Serial Controller D (0x2303), rev 1.10/4.00, addr 53
Jun 28 14:27:10 slave /netbsd: [ 2332166.8096137] ucom2 at uplcom1
Jun 28 14:27:10 slave /netbsd: [ 2332166.8246139] ucom2: detached
Jun 28 14:27:10 slave /netbsd: [ 2332166.8246139] uplcom1: detached
Jun 28 14:27:10 slave /netbsd: [ 2332166.8246139] uplcom1: at uhub1 port 8 (addr 53) disconnected
Jun 28 14:27:11 slave /netbsd: [ 2332167.3396223] uplcom1 at uhub1 port 8
Jun 28 14:27:11 slave /netbsd: [ 2332167.3396223] uplcom1: Prolific Technology Inc. (0x067b) USB-Serial Controller D (0x2303), rev 1.10/4.00, addr 54
Jun 28 14:27:11 slave /netbsd: [ 2332167.3606226] ucom2 at uplcom1

crash> bt
__kernel_end() at 0
kern_reboot() at sys_reboot
vpanic() at vpanic+0x18d
panic() at vprintf
trap() at startlwp
--- trap (number 6) ---
ucompoll() at ucompoll+0x2a
cdev_poll() at cdev_poll+0x87
spec_poll() at spec_poll+0x6a
VOP_POLL() at VOP_POLL+0x5d
sel_do_scan() at sel_do_scan+0x3ba
selcommon() at selcommon+0x309
sys___select50() at sys___select50+0x75
syscall() at syscall+0x1fc
--- syscall (number 417) ---
syscall+0x1fc:

Have core and kernel with symbols.

>How-To-Repeat:

>Fix:



Home | Main Index | Thread Index | Old Index